No traffic touring cycling routes around Rouillon, France, are characterized by a rural setting with gentle relief, featuring bocage valleys and the Rouillon wood. The area is part of the Le Mans Métropole, which has developed a "Boulevard Nature" project, providing a network of paths for cycling. These routes often traverse varied terrain, including wooded areas and valleys, offering a pleasant experience for touring cyclists. The landscape provides a mix of open countryside and shaded sections, ideal for car-free exploration.

  • The most popular no traffic touring cycling route is Prairie House – Arche de la Nature loop from Le Mans, a 20.7 miles (33.4 km) trail that takes 2 hours 40 minutes to complete. This moderate route explores the natural areas around Le Mans.
  • Another top favourite among local touring cyclists is Moulinsart Island – Sarthe loop from Le Mans Gare Sud, a moderate 31.3 miles (50.5 km) path. This route follows the Sarthe river, offering scenic views and a relatively flat profile.
  • Local touring cyclists also love the Logistra France Mural – L'Épau Abbey loop from Le Mans Gare Nord, a 33.4 miles (53.8 km) trail leading through varied landscapes including the historic L'Épau Abbey, often completed in about 4 hours 8 minutes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the no-traffic cycling routes near Rouillon?

The routes around Rouillon, particularly those utilizing the 'Boulevard Nature' network, often feature varied terrain. You can expect gentle relief through 'vallons bocagers' (bocage valleys) and wooded areas like the 'bois de Rouillon'. Many paths are well-maintained and suitable for touring bikes, offering a mix of riverside paths and pleasant countryside.

What are some notable landmarks or attractions I can see along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Many routes pass by significant local attractions. For instance, the Logistra France Mural – L'Épau Abbey loop from Le Mans Gare Nord will take you past the historic L'Épau Abbey. You can also explore the Arche de la Nature, a large natural park, which is featured in routes like the Arche de la Nature – L'Épau Abbey loop from Le Mans.
